From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: From: Led To: ALT Devel discussion list Subject: Re: [devel] --enable-mmx =?koi8-r?b?ySBhcmNo?= =?koi8-r?b?INDBy8XUz9c=?= Date: Mon, 27 Feb 2006 11:18:03 +0200 User-Agent: KMail/1.9.1 References: <200602251539.59002.thresh@altlinux.ru> <31313.127.0.0.1.1140872293.squirrel@mojo.myroom.ru> In-Reply-To: <31313.127.0.0.1.1140872293.squirrel@mojo.myroom.ru> MIME-Version: 1.0 Content-Type: text/plain; charset="koi8-r" Content-Transfer-Encoding: 8bit Content-Disposition: inline Message-Id: <200602271118.03298.led@altlinux.ru> X-BeenThere: devel@lists.altlinux.org X-Mailman-Version: 2.1.6 Precedence: list Reply-To: ALT Devel discussion list List-Id: ALT Devel discussion list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 27 Feb 2006 09:17:56 -0000 Archived-At: List-Archive: List-Post: В сообщении от 25 февраля 2006 14:58 Konstantin A. Lepikhov написал(a): > <цитата от="Pavlov Konstantin"> > > > Привет всем. > > > > Это нормально, когда пакет собирается с --enable-mmx и в результате > > сборки его > > arch - i586? > > why not? Программа должна сама уметь узнавать о дополнительных > возможностях CPU, и переходить в режим совместимости, если этих > возможностей нет. А если не умеет? Как заставить собирать incoming под i686 или даже под pentium4? Примеры: 1) libxvid: под i586 использовать нет смысла, потому как скорость его работы, собранного без ассемблерного i686-кода - раз 5 ниже. 2) libx264 - без ассемблерного кода MMX вобще не собирается, так что сборка в сизифе i586 не совсем "честная". А для сборки с SSE2 (что очень полезно для производительности сего прожорливого кодека) вобще нужен минимум --target=pentium4. -- Led.